Understanding Mosquito Bites and Skin Reactions

Mosquito bites are more than just tiny annoyances; they trigger a complex immune response in the skin. When a mosquito bites, it injects saliva containing proteins that prevent blood clotting. The body’s immune system reacts by releasing histamines, causing redness, swelling, itching, and sometimes pain at the bite site. This reaction varies from person to person—some experience minor irritation, while others suffer from intense itching or allergic responses.

The primary goal when treating mosquito bites is to reduce inflammation and calm the irritated skin. Common remedies include antihistamines, topical corticosteroids, and soothing agents like aloe vera or calamine lotion. But what about chlorine? It’s a chemical widely used as a disinfectant in pools and water treatment. Could it help with mosquito bite relief?

The Role of Chlorine on Skin

Chlorine is a powerful oxidizing agent used to kill bacteria and other pathogens in water. It’s effective in maintaining hygiene but is also known for its drying and irritating effects on skin. When exposed to chlorine, especially in swimming pools, the skin can become dry, flaky, or itchy due to the disruption of natural oils.

This drying effect might seem beneficial for inflamed mosquito bites at first glance because it can reduce moisture that sometimes worsens itching. However, chlorine’s harshness often aggravates sensitive or broken skin rather than soothing it.

Repeated exposure to chlorine can strip away the skin’s protective barrier. This leads to increased sensitivity and susceptibility to irritation from external factors—including insect bites.

Can Chlorine Kill Bacteria on Mosquito Bites?

Mosquito bites can occasionally get infected if scratched excessively. In theory, since chlorine kills bacteria effectively on surfaces and in water, it might help disinfect a bite site. But applying chlorine directly to skin is not recommended because it can cause chemical burns or worsen irritation.

Safe antiseptics designed specifically for skin—like hydrogen peroxide or iodine—are much better choices for cleaning infected wounds or preventing infection after scratching mosquito bites.

Scientific Evidence on Chlorine Use for Mosquito Bites

There is limited scientific research supporting the use of chlorine as a treatment for mosquito bites. Medical literature focuses mainly on topical anti-itch creams containing hydrocortisone or antihistamines rather than disinfectants like chlorine.

A few studies have explored swimming pool exposure and its effects on skin conditions such as eczema or dermatitis but not specifically on insect bite relief. These studies generally conclude that chlorine exposure tends to worsen inflammation rather than alleviate it.

In fact, dermatologists warn against using chlorinated water directly on open wounds or irritated skin because of its potential to cause further damage.

Common Myths About Chlorine and Mosquito Bites

There are some popular beliefs that swimming in chlorinated pools helps reduce mosquito bite itching due to the cooling effect of water combined with chlorine’s disinfecting properties. While cool water can temporarily relieve itching by numbing nerve endings, this benefit comes from temperature—not chlorine itself.

Another myth suggests that applying diluted bleach (which contains chlorine) can heal insect bites faster. This practice is dangerous; bleach is highly caustic and can cause severe burns and scarring if applied to delicate skin areas.

Safe Alternatives for Treating Mosquito Bites

Instead of risking irritation with chlorine-based products, consider these proven remedies:

    • Cold Compress: Applying an ice pack or cold cloth reduces swelling and numbs nerve endings.
    • Calamine Lotion: Soothes itchiness with its cooling properties without harsh chemicals.
    • Aloe Vera Gel: Natural anti-inflammatory that hydrates while calming irritated skin.
    • Topical Antihistamines: Creams containing diphenhydramine block histamine receptors to reduce itching.
    • Hydrocortisone Cream: Mild steroid that decreases inflammation effectively.
    • Oral Antihistamines: Medications like cetirizine or loratadine help systemic allergic reactions.

These options have been tested extensively for safety and effectiveness on sensitive skin areas affected by insect bites.

The Impact of Chlorinated Pools on Mosquito Bite Symptoms

Swimming in chlorinated pools exposes your body to both cool water and low levels of chlorine simultaneously. While the cool water may temporarily soothe itchiness caused by mosquito bites, the chlorine component can dry out your skin significantly after you leave the pool.

Dryness leads to cracked or flaky skin which might exacerbate discomfort from existing mosquito bites or make you more prone to new irritations.

It’s important to rinse off thoroughly with fresh water after swimming in chlorinated pools and apply moisturizer immediately afterward. This routine helps restore moisture balance while removing residual chlorine residue.

Chlorine Concentration Levels in Pools vs Skin Safety

Pool water usually contains free chlorine concentrations between 1-3 parts per million (ppm). This level is safe for swimming but still potent enough to disinfect bacteria effectively.

However, direct application of concentrated chlorine solutions (much higher than pool levels) onto broken skin would be harmful rather than healing. The following table illustrates typical free chlorine concentrations versus their effects:

Chlorine Concentration (ppm) Common Use/Application Effect on Skin
0 – 0.5 ppm Treated drinking water No noticeable effect; safe for ingestion
1 – 3 ppm Swimming pools Mild drying; generally safe if exposure is limited
>5 ppm Disinfectant solutions (household use) Irritation; potential chemical burns if applied directly on skin

This shows why using household bleach or concentrated chlorine products as a remedy for mosquito bites is unsafe.

The Science Behind Itching Relief: Why Chlorine Falls Short

Itching from mosquito bites stems largely from histamine release triggering nerve signals interpreted as itch sensations by your brain. Effective itch relief targets either:

    • The inflammatory process (reducing swelling)
    • Nerve signal transmission (numbing sensation)

Chlorine neither blocks histamine nor numbs nerves adequately—it mainly acts as an antimicrobial agent with drying effects that may worsen inflammation indirectly by damaging the skin barrier.

Conversely, ingredients like menthol provide cooling sensations that distract nerves from itch signals, while corticosteroids suppress immune responses causing swelling.

Avoiding Complications: Risks of Using Chlorine Improperly

Applying undiluted chlorine-containing products directly onto mosquito bites risks:

    • Chemical Burns: Especially if applied repeatedly or left on sensitive areas.
    • Increased Irritation: Worsening redness and swelling due to disrupted protective oils.
    • Delayed Healing: Damaged skin barrier slows recovery time.

These hazards outweigh any theoretical benefits from disinfection since most mosquito bite infections respond well to gentler antiseptics designed for human tissue compatibility.
